Sustainable materials are shifting the design parameters of flexible seal packaging. As a professional converter, Jieyang Yuanzhong is evolving from multi-material non-recyclable laminations toward recyclable and biodegradable mono-material polymer structures.
Traditional high-barrier bags utilize complex PET/AL/PE laminations that resist recycling. Our development path focuses on Mono-PE and Mono-PP structures that match the oxygen/moisture barrier standards of composite foils while meeting strict European and North American circular economy regulations.
We combine biodegradable Polylactic Acid (PLA) polymers with sustainably sourced natural Kraft paper to produce robust barrier packaging. These composite bags decompose naturally under commercial composting conditions, helping brands minimize environmental impact.
By refining the melt flow indexes of internal linear low-density polyethylenes (LLDPE), our sealing films maintain structural integrity across wide thermal processing windows. This avoids seam failures even when packing powder, lipids, or volatile chemical compounds.
| Material Configuration | WVTR (g/m²/24hr) | OTR (cc/m²/24hr/atm) | Recyclability Rating | Primary Industrial Use Case |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| PET / AL / LLDPE (Foil Laminate) | < 0.01 | < 0.01 | Non-Recyclable | Long shelf-life milk powders, dehydrated foods, military rations |
| BOPA / LLDPE (Nylon Laminate) | < 0.8 | < 25.0 | Hard to Recycle | Heavy liquid stand-up pouches, pet food, puncture-prone materials |
| MDO-PE / EVOH / PE (High-Barrier Mono) | < 0.15 | < 0.5 | Fully Recyclable (Code 4) | Sustainable snack food packaging, organic cereals, retail foods |
| Kraft Paper / PLA (Bio-based) | < 2.5 | < 85.0 | Industrial Composting | Eco-friendly specialty tea/coffee pouching, organic snack packaging |

Our food-grade films comply with FDA regulations and EC Directives. Formulations with EVOH and metallized barriers block oxygen and water vapor transmission, preventing staling and rancidity in snack foods, potato chips, and dry goods.
Pet diets require robust packaging designed to resist fats, maintain oil barrier properties, and withstand puncturing. Our multi-layer co-extrusion technology produces flat-bottom and quad-seal bags that support heavy weight loads while preventing grease migration.
For packaging fine chemicals, seeds, and soil additives, sealing security is critical. Our heavy-duty industrial LDPE-blend materials resist punctures, environmental stress cracking, and acid/alkali exposures, ensuring transport safety.

Gravure printing remains a preferred method for printing packaging materials at high volumes. Utilizing metal cylinders etched with microscopic ink cells, this system applies deep ink layers that produce high color saturation, clean fine lines, and stable color density across millions of linear meters. Combined with electronic register controls, it maintains visual quality at running speeds of up to 250 meters per minute.
